Answers
- D. The Shining – Jack Nicholson’s Jack Torrance shouts this while axing through a bathroom door in the 1980 horror classic. The others are iconic horrors but lack this exact line.
- A. The Godfather – Marlon Brando’s Don Vito Corleone utters this mafia promise in the 1972 masterpiece. Other gangster films share themes but not the quote.
- C. Forrest Gump – Tom Hanks’ character shares this wisdom from his mother in the 1994 Best Picture winner. Distractors are fellow Hanks dramas.
- D. A Few Good Men – Jack Nicholson’s Col. Jessup explodes with this courtroom outburst in the 1992 drama. Others are legal thrillers without it.
- B. The Empire Strikes Back – Darth Vader reveals the truth to Luke Skywalker in the 1980 Star Wars sequel. Not from the other saga entries listed.
- C. E.T. the Extra-Terrestrial – The alien utters this plea to phone home in Spielberg’s 1982 family sci-fi hit. Others are alien encounter films.
- A. Field of Dreams – The mysterious voice whispers this to Ray Kinsella in the 1989 baseball fantasy. Distractors are sports dramas.
- D. Jerry Maguire – Cuba Gooding Jr.’s Rod Tidwell demands this from Tom Cruise in the 1996 rom-com. Others are 90s comedies.
- B. The Wizard of Oz – Dorothy says this upon landing in Oz in the 1939 musical classic. Not from other period fantasies.
- C. Titanic – Leonardo DiCaprio’s Jack yells this from the bow in the 1997 epic. Distractors are nautical adventures.
- A. Home Alone – Kevin’s uncle taunts the burglars via recording in the 1990 holiday comedy. Others are family mischief films.
- D. Clueless – Cher Horowitz’s signature dismissal in the 1995 teen satire. Popularised the phrase, unlike similar teen flicks.
- B. King Kong – Denham’s closing line about the giant ape in the 1933 monster original. Others feature beasts but not this dialogue.
- C. White Heat – James Cagney’s Cody Jarrett exults before his demise in the 1949 gangster classic. Iconic Cagney line, not in his other roles listed.
- A. All About Eve – Bette Davis’ Margo Channing warns theatregoers in the 1950 Best Picture winner. Distractors are Davis-led noirs.
- D. The Wizard of Oz – Dorothy Gale’s realisation upon arriving in Munchkinland in the 1939 Technicolor landmark. Not from Oz adaptations.
- B. Airplane! – Leslie Nielsen’s Dr. Rumack deadpans this in the 1980 comedy spoof. Defines the parody series, unlike follow-ups.
- A. Aliens – Bill Paxton’s Hudson panics during the xenomorph assault in the 1986 action sequel. Not from other sci-fi horrors listed.
- C. There Will Be Blood – Daniel Day-Lewis’ oil tycoon Daniel Plainview rants this in the 2007 Paul Thomas Anderson epic. Exclusive to this PT Anderson film.
- B. Marathon Man – Laurence Olivier’s Nazi dentist tortures Dustin Hoffman with this question in the 1976 thriller. Classic from 70s conspiracy films.
